Manufacturing Quality Control of ETHYL 2-METHOXYPHENOXYACETATE

Detection Item Common Analytical Method Method Overview
Assay (Purity) Gas Chromatography (GC) with FID detection Quantifies main component by retention time and peak area comparison against certified reference standard.
Related Substances Gas Chromatography-Mass Spectrometry (GC-MS) Identifies and semi-quantifies impurities based on mass spectral fragmentation patterns and retention behavior.
Water Content Karl Fischer Titration Measures water via stoichiometric reaction between iodine, sulfur dioxide, and water in pyridine/methanol medium.
Acid Value Acid-Base Titration with NaOH Determines free acid content by titration with standardized sodium hydroxide solution using phenolphthalein indicator.
Residue on Ignition Gravimetric Analysis (Weight Loss on Ignition) Measures non-volatile inorganic residue after high-temperature ashing at 700-800 C.
Heavy Metals Atomic Absorption Spectroscopy (AAS) Quantifies trace metal contaminants (e.g., Pb, Cd, Hg) by atomic absorption of characteristic wavelengths.
Chloride Content Ion Chromatography (IC) Separates and quantifies chloride ions using anion-exchange column and conductivity detection.
Color (APHA) Visual Comparison or Spectrophotometric Measurement Evaluates sample yellowness by matching to APHA color standards or measuring absorbance at 430 nm.
Density Digital Density Meter Determines mass per unit volume at specified temperature (e.g., 20 C) using oscillating U-tube principle.
Refractive Index Refractometry Measures bending of light through liquid sample at specified temperature using calibrated refractometer.
Flash Point Closed Cup Pensky-Martens Tester Determines lowest temperature at which vapors ignite under controlled heating and ignition source.
Organic Volatile Impurities Headspace Gas Chromatography (HS-GC) Detects residual solvents by analyzing vapor phase above heated sample using GC-FID or GC-MS.

Technical Specifications of ETHYL 2-METHOXYPHENOXYACETATE

Test Item Specification
Appearance Pale-yellow liquid
Purity >=98.0%
Total Impurities <=2.0%
Water Content (KF) <=0.5%
Refractive Index (n20/D) 1.512–1.518
Relative Density (20°C/25°C) 1.085–1.095 g/cm³
Odor Characteristic ester-like odor
Identification (NMR) Consistent with structure
